Researchers at Harvard’s Wyss Institute for Biologically Inspired Engineering have created a device that mimics a living, breathing human lung on a microchip. The device, about the size of a rubber eraser, acts much like a lung in a human body and is made using human lung and blood vessel cells.
In nature, cells and tissues assemble and organize themselves within a matrix of protein fibers that ultimately determines their structure and function, such as the elasticity of skin and the contractility of heart tissue. These natural design principles have now been successfully replicated in the lab by bioengineers at Harvard’s Wyss Institute for Biologically Inspired Engineering and School of Engineering and Applied Sciences.

Over three-quarters of youths under age 15 who die in firearm accidents are shot by another person, usually another youth, according to new research from the Harvard School of Public Health (HSPH). It is the first multi-state, in-depth study of who fires the shot in unintentional firearm fatalities.
